Tender Overview

Armoured Vehicles Nigam Limited invites bids for the procurement of a FORGING SHACKLE aligned to DRG. NO. 675-53-182 under an OPEN TENDER ENQUIRY. The scope is limited to the supply of goods, with no BOQ items published, and includes a mandatory 12‑month warranty. The tender specifies an option clause allowing up to 50% quantity variation at contracted rates and a delivery framework tied to the original delivery period with calculation-based extensions. Pre-dispatch inspection is not selected; post-receipt inspection is conducted by the CGM or their authorized representative at the consignee site. Packing and marking requirements ensure proper transit protection and clear identification of the supplier and S.O. details. Vendor sign-off on the attached Technical Compliance Sheet is mandatory to avoid rejection.
